Default Mobile 1 Filter

The local auto parts store (Advance Auto) is having a deal on 5 Quarts of Mobil 1 with an oil filter for $29.99. For a reason I don't understand, they almost never stock Mobil 1 filters for small blocks. The book lists the correct filter as a M1-111, however, the guy working there says he uses an M1-302. I'm using an M1-111 on my ZZ4 small block, but I'm wondering which Mobil 1 filter would be best to use because the M1-111 is a short filter without a lot of volume.

So, what Mobil 1 filter are you putting on your small block?

M1-302. It is the replacement for the PF-35. The books list it for the trucks with small blocks.

I like having the extra 1/2 quart of oil. Same price for a little piece of mind.
